AVONVALE U11s rounded off their season, in which they won every game, with a 6-1 victory at Malmesbury.
Malmesbury U11s 1
Avonvale Utd U11s 6
They took the lead early on when Benjamin Cook hammered the ball in from close range following a corner.
Dom Randall made it two following brilliant play down the right between Ben Lemos and Lewis Rodgers, who then converted another corner to make it 3-0.
Just before half-time it was 4-0 with Dom scoring an incredible 34th goal in just 11 games this season.
They continued their excellent play into the second half, but were lucky when a defender turned Flynn Walton’s saved penalty into his own net before Inigo Fenwick scored his first of the season with a brilliant finish having just come out of goal.
Malmesbury got one back towards the end but Avonvale’s defence stood firm thereafter.
